Julie Delpy, born in Paris to French parents, is an accomplished French-American actress known for her roles in over 30 films. After studying at New York University's Tisch School of the Arts, she became a US citizen. She rose to prominence with her role as Béatrice in 'La Passion Béatrice' (1987), a film about a young girl caught in her war-hardened father's abusive behavior during the Hundred Years' War.

In 'Les mille merveilles de l'univers', humanity lives in fear of an alien invasion after receiving a coded message from space. When the residents of Sepulveda suddenly disappear, authorities quarantine the area. Strange magnetic phenomena are observed, leading military authorities to suspect an alien offensive. They send Professor Larsen, a renowned astrophysicist specialized in UFOs, to investigate the ghost town.
